y2lamanaki Posted August 10, 2017 Author Share Posted August 10, 2017 Quote Carlos Hyde and Tim Hightower are one-two in the lineup. The others have been rotating among the second- and third-team groups. Matt Breida has been the most consistent of the bunch and has outshined fourth-round draft pick Joe Williams to date. "He’s got a chip on his shoulder, which you love." Shanahan said of the undrafted rookie. "He’s trying to prove himself every single day. It doesn’t matter whether it’s a run play, a pass play, whether he’s in protection. The guy loves competing. He’s a talented guy on top of it and he’s a guy who you definitely can tell he’s giving it his all.” ^Update from Barrows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
